How to Classify an Import

Please help, my wife is pulling her hair out. She just imported a bunch of photos from her phone. She is trying to classify them by putting them in folders describing the event. She is doing this by dragging photos from the 'Last Import' view over into the newly created folders. However, once she drags photos over, they still appear in the 'Last Import' list. I understand the reason for this (because even though they are in a new folder, they are also still considered 'Last Import'). How can I create a Smart Album to show the 'last import' that has not been named in a photo or album? Can you classify an import?

I'm not sure you can but Try this (I can not test because High Sierra works differently)


make a new smart album (file menu ==> new smart album)

two criteria and meets all criteria

1 - Album - is not - any

2 - Album - is - last import



If this is not possible (and I think it probably is not) you can make the second criteria

Date - is -- [the date of the photos]

or

Date - is in the range - [the dates of the photos]



It probably will turn out that just being disciplined in adding photos to albums will be the best answer along with a smart album for -- Album - is not - any
